If n(A) = 5, n(B) = 3 and n(A ∩ B) = 2, then n(A ∪ B) is:

Answer: 6.

  • A 6
  • B 8
  • C 10
  • D 4

Correct answer: A. 6

Explanation: n(A ∪ B) = n(A) + n(B) − n(A ∩ B) = 5 + 3 − 2 = 6.

A Venn diagram makes set identities visual: A∪B is everything inside either circle, A∩B is only the overlap, and the region outside both circles represents the complement of their union - directly illustrating De Morgan's law (A∪B)′ = A′∩B′.
